What is Lens Protocol?

Lens Protocol is an open source and composable social graph based on web3 and built on the Polygon blockchain. The project aims to enable developers to launch Web3-based social media platforms and profiles. It gives creators control over their connection to their community and helps them retain ownership of whatever content they create.

This protocol attempts to find solutions to emerging challenges and problems related to web2. In order to understand how the protocol works, it is very important to know these issues.

Problems with Web2

Lens Protocol is tuned to solve problems with web2 social media interaction. One of the problems with Web2 is the strict autonomy controlled by central companies. These companies can choose to suspend accounts at any time, making it possible to lose followers and content you already have.

Web2 social media platforms manage comments and posts and have forms of censorship on accounts and content; many are even seen as unacceptable. Unfortunately, well-meaning posts are often removed as part of the process.

Web2 social media platforms have central servers. As a result, your data, account and followers are controlled by the company that created the platform. Your interaction is within the platform and the company uses your information and monetizes your content without your consent.

How to Use Lens Protocol?

The principle of using Lens Protocol is that it provides an easy way for interested users to create their own social media platforms for their desired use.

A social graph is a structure that shows the interconnections between people and groups in a social network. The structure is created when you create profiles, follow users, create content, and associate them with other content.

Centralized social media apps like Instagram, Facebook, Twitter, and TikTok use social graphics, among other things, to manipulate content and create a convenient user experience for users. Lens Protocol, on the other hand, integrates social graphics into a smart contract and allows users to build their social media platforms and communities independently of any centralized control.

Unlike centralized social media companies, Lens Protocol’s source codes are open and permissionless, allowing anyone to develop them. This access allows you to create follower-specific solutions for those in your network.

Lens Protocol Features

Lens Protocol allows you to perform activities similar to those found on Web2 social media platforms with a few additional features.

1. Profile Tracking

When you follow a profile you are given the option to “Follow NFT”. You can also add a tracking module, just like a condition, to determine whether a tracking NFT should be given to someone who wants to track you.

2. Publications

Represents posts and interactions. Posts are generated content. You can also comment on posts and mirror posts. Mirroring a post is like sharing what someone else has posted.

3. Gathering

The Aggregation feature allows you to monetize your content. You can set your collection parameters such as the time the collection is open, the maximum number users can collect. You can also sell NFT with this module.

4. Management

This feature allows you to create a social media account where followers can vote when making important decisions.

How the Lens Protocol Works

Lens Protocol has a system designed to solve web2 problems. Therefore, the working principle also depends on it. All Lens Protocol profiles are in NFT format. You have an NFT that represents your identity, and you connect with those NFTs to connect with people. That way, everyone involved gets control over their own identity.

Within the protocol, you can also transfer members of your community from one social media platform to another. Unlike Web2 social media platforms, you don’t have to start over to get new followers on another social media platform, as you can easily transfer your community to a new platform.

Lens Protocol is censorship resistant. You have full control over your content as it is not on any central server. Building on the Lens Protocol means that no central authority can shut you down as you have full control over your platform and community.
